Abstract :
This paper discusses the conversion efficiency and device behavior of an edge-coupled membrane photonic transmitter, which is composed of a high-speed photodetector, a RF choke filter and planar antenna. With a radiation frequency of 645 GHz, the conversion efficiency can be improved higher than 0.1% while this value is a function of optical illumination power, device bias, and antenna design.
